some important pts. while u r doing binomial theorem.............
1)
nc
r is maximum for a given value of n

r
a) wen n is even ............r = n/2
b)wen n is odd ..............r = n+1/2 or n-1/2
2)co-eff. of terms equidistant frm the beginning and end in the expansion of (x + a)n are equal
3)(1+x)-k = k + r - 1cr . xr
4)no. of dissimilar terms in the expansion of (x + y + z)n is ( n + 1 )( n + 2 ) / 2
5)In the expansion of (x + a)n (x , a >0 ) the greatest term is Tm+1 where m is the largest +ive integer 'r' satisfying [n-r+1.a] / rx >= 1
6)if x > 0 , then the greatest co-eff. in the expansion of (1+x)n is
a)ncn/2 if n is even
b)nc(n-1)/2 or nc(n+1)/2 if n is odd
7 ) If the index 'n' is even then there is only 1 middle term in the expansion of (x+a)n i.e = (n+2)/2 th term
8)If the index 'n' is odd, then there are 2 middle terms in the expansion of (x+a)n i.e = (n+1)/2th and (n+3)/2th terms
9)sum of co-eff. in the expansion of (x+a)n is 2n
10)sum of co-eff. of odd terms = sum of coeff of even terms i.e 2n-1
